Join the World Conference on Transport Research Society (WCTRS) SIG B5 (Freight Transport Modeling) for an engaging webinar introducing key concepts in freight modeling and emerging innovations shaping the field. Designed for both new practitioners and experienced researchers, the session will feature a freight modeling primer, an overview of the MASS-GT multi-agent simulation for urban freight, and insights into building a National Digital Twin for Freight and Logistics. Discover how these tools can support data-driven planning, policy evaluation, & sustainable freight solutions across local and national contexts.
On December 11th, ASCE's Making the Grade Webinar Series will showcase drinking water and wastewater infrastructure. Following the release of the 2025 Report Card for America's Infrastructure, the webinar will explore issues and solutions for both drinking water and wastewater across key criteria, including funding, resilience, and capacity. The event features an overview of both chapters and provides rationale for the grades. Additionally, panelists will discuss on-the-ground experiences linking the report to the work of practitioners.
